Transaction 04452b71d8423589bf2f967b0c4b8583e8b68b97f9a282b81ea87df4c321f059
1 Input
1 Output
-
04452b71d8423589bf2f967b0c4b8583e8b68b97f9a282b81ea87df4c321f059:0
- value
- 250378625
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51ff0d001c0a0a8c370e6a94228cdbdbec5291e2 OP_EQUAL
- address
- 39AaCKaQ3Ym6LPpaDkcHMk7CR4j7mkvRjb